MCD Collaborates with DTTDC to Restore and Repurpose Delhi's Town Hall Building

The Municipal Corporation of Delhi (MCD) is collaborating with the Delhi Tourism and Transport Development Corporation (DTTDC) to restore and repurpose the 160-year-old Town Hall building in Chandni Chowk. Classified as a Grade-A heritage structure, the plan aims to conserve its historical character while opening it to the public as a cultural center under a revenue-sharing model. Initial restoration costs are estimated to exceed Rs 100 crore, with detailed proposals underway following MCD's recent request to DTTDC.
